RE: #1 rule, hands in RZR at all times. WARNING GRAPHIC PHOTOS

Sorry guys, been busy. Here is an update for you.
The first emergency repair was a dud. The plate the Dr. put in was the wrong part and installed wrong at that. My arm started growing in a U shape. The plate ended up braking in half in early Dec due to to much pressure. All I was doing when it happened was steadying myself from getting up from a chair. Heard a loud pop; didn't feel a thing. Started hurting a few hours later. Had a new "wrist specialist" by now and he verified I broke the plate. We scheduled a new reconstruction surgery 10 Jan where they took a bone graft out of my hip to replace my shattered radius bone. The surgery went very well and at just over two months the Dr. has released me. I have 90% of my motion back already and strength is at about 60%. I'm still in pain because of the continued healing, but all is well. I can drive a car, lift weights and more importantly drive my RZR. Hope this never happens to any of you. Been a pretty tough 6 months, but many have experienced worse. Thanks,

RE: Towing Cyclone 4100 King

You will be 1000lbs + over your rear axle weight and 2000lbs over your GVWR with that trailer. Your truck is only rated at 14k or so towing. At 7.5k empty for the truck, add 3500lbs of pin(trust me it will be that high) and all the stuff you put in the truck, you will be 2000lbs over. Don't do it. I have towed a 40' toyhauler at 15k lbs on a 2500 before. It's not the best setup and I have over 20 years of heavy tow experience.
